                      Dawson's style and physical attributes are the reasons why he beat B-Hop imho, and I think he'd beat him again if they fought. B-Hop fights at a slow pace, isn't as fast and is at a reach disadvantage. Dawson being capable of beating B-Hop shouldn't be a surprise.

                      Adonis isn't cagey and experienced like B-Hop, but he can match Dawson's physical attributes. Dawson could out-match B-Hop with athleticism and length, but Adonis is just as athletic and has the same reach. He's also aggressive and has confidence in his power. Dawson had issues with Pascal's aggression, so I knew that Adonis would pose an issue. However, Adonis did what Pascal couldn't and got a decisive W.
